PortalRankings.com
 

Websites linking back to 80.75.1.84

1 websites are linking back to 80.75.1.84 in their content.

 
Total results: 1
Domains on this page: 1
 

Results:

سايت اصلي
http://portalrankings.com/info/kordestancement.ir
Home
    2024-06-14 23:49:54 || 0.3615